In order to achieve the above purpose, the utility model adopts the following technical scheme: a body fluid sample temporary storage device for clinical detection comprises a temporary storage box, an inner box body and a test tube fixing frame, wherein an ultraviolet disinfection lamp is fixed on the inner mounting side surface of the temporary storage box, a detachable storage battery is mounted inside the left side of the temporary storage box, a control switch is embedded and mounted on the temporary storage box at the upper end of the storage battery, a guide rod is fixed at the bottom of the temporary storage box, the upper end of the guide rod penetrates through a guide sleeve at the lower end of the inner box body, a buffer spring is sleeved on the guide rod below the guide sleeve, the upper end of the inner box body and the upper end of the temporary storage box are sealed through a connected protecting sleeve, and a temporary storage box cover is hinged to; interior box internally mounted has the test tube mount, and the inboard bottom of interior box evenly is provided with the silica gel column, has seted up the test tube fixed orifices on the test tube mount, and the inside sample test tube of having placed of test tube fixed orifices to test tube mount installs splint in the bottom, and the case lid bottom of keeping in the case upper end installation is fixed with the rubber pad, and the four prismatic table structures and the lag phase-match of rubber pad.
The body fluid sample temporary storage device for clinical detection is characterized in that the ultraviolet disinfection lamps are installed on four sides of the inner side of the temporary storage box, the four ultraviolet disinfection lamps are higher than the inner box body, the four ultraviolet disinfection lamps installed on the side face and the ultraviolet disinfection lamps installed at the bottom are connected in series with the storage battery through electric wires, and meanwhile, a control switch is installed on a circuit connected with the storage battery and the ultraviolet disinfection lamps.
The body fluid sample temporary storage device for clinical detection is characterized in that the inner box body is made of square PE transparent plastic, the protecting sleeves arranged on four sides above the inner box body are made of soft and transparent medical silica gel, and the silica gel column is a silica gel column made of medical silica gel.
Foretell body fluid sample temporary storage device for clinical examination, wherein, two rows of test tube fixed orificess seted up on the test tube mount, and the test tube mount bottom of test tube fixed orificess both sides is fixed with the slide rail, and slidable mounting has splint on the slide rail to two sets of corresponding splint are all installed to both sides around the test tube fixed orificess bottom.
Foretell body fluid sample temporary storage device for clinical examination, wherein, the splint that the test tube fixed orifices outside set up are fixed with the splint spring to splint spring rear end is fixed on the curb plate.
Foretell body fluid sample temporary storage device for clinical examination, wherein, the splint rear end of slidable mounting is fixed with the splint spring on the slide rail that sets up on the test tube fixed orifices below, and splint spring rear end is fixed on the test tube mount.
Foretell body fluid sample temporary storage device for clinical examination, wherein, the spout has been seted up to splint bottom side, and spout slidable mounting is on the slide rail to splint inside sets up the double-layered groove of round platform shape, is provided with vertical slope guide way on the double-layered groove side simultaneously, and sets up horizontal transverse guide way on the perpendicular side of double-layered groove bottom.
Foretell body fluid sample temporary storage device for clinical examination, wherein, splint and test tube mount are PE transparent plastic material and constitute, and the test tube mount outside encircles the thickness of the side plate that sets up and is the same with the thickness of splint to the inside double-layered inslot portion of seting up of splint has medical silica gel pad through glue paste.
The body fluid sample temporary storage device for clinical detection is characterized in that an ultraviolet disinfection lamp is mounted on the temporary storage cover in the rubber pad.
3. Advantageous effects
To sum up, the beneficial effects of the utility model reside in that:
(1) the utility model adopts the double-layer shell, and the double-layer shell is connected by the protective cover of the transparent medical silica gel, and can be sterilized by the ultraviolet disinfection lamp;
(2) the utility model adopts the structure that the bottom of the inner box body is provided with the buffering spring, which plays the role of shock absorption and reduces the shaking of the inner box body, the test tube is placed on the test tube fixing frame, the bottom of the test tube fixing frame is provided with the silica gel column, and the bottom of the test tube fixing frame is slidably provided with the clamp plate which fixes the test tube, so that the test tube is firmer;
(3) the utility model discloses a splint inside sets up the double-layered groove of round platform type, and the slope guide way of test tube bottom contact double-layered groove side props open splint, promotes splint through the spring and makes the test tube press from both sides tightly, convenient operation.

Referring to fig. 1 to 5, a temporary storage device for clinical testing body fluid samples comprises a temporary storage box 1, an inner box body 8 and a test tube fixing frame 12, wherein an ultraviolet disinfection lamp 9 is fixed on the inner side of the temporary storage box 1, a detachable storage battery 3 is installed in the temporary storage box 1 at the left side, a control switch 2 is embedded on the temporary storage box 1 at the upper end of the storage battery 3, a guide rod 4 is fixed at the bottom of the temporary storage box 1, the upper end of the guide rod 4 is arranged on a guide sleeve 7 at the lower end of the inner box body 8 in a penetrating manner, a buffer spring 6 is sleeved on the guide rod 4 below the guide sleeve 7, the upper end of the inner box body 8 is sealed with the upper end of the temporary storage box 1 through a connected protective sleeve 10, the ultraviolet disinfection lamps 9 are installed on four sides of the inner side of the temporary storage box 1, the four ultraviolet disinfection lamps 9 are higher than the inner box body 8 in height, and the four ultraviolet disinfection lamps 9 installed on the side and the, meanwhile, a control switch 2 is installed on a circuit connecting the storage battery 3 and the ultraviolet disinfection lamp 9, the upper end of the temporary storage box 1 is hinged with a temporary storage box cover 13 through a hinged seat 15, a test tube fixing frame 12 is installed inside the inner box body 8, a silica gel column 5 is evenly arranged at the bottom of the inner side of the inner box body 8, the inner box body 8 is made of square PE transparent plastic, a protective sleeve 10 arranged on four sides above the inner box body 8 is made of soft transparent medical silica gel, the silica gel column 5 is a rubber column made of medical silica gel, a test tube fixing hole 16 is formed in the test tube fixing frame 12, a sample test tube 11 is placed inside the test tube fixing hole 16, a clamping plate 17 is installed at the bottom of the test tube fixing frame 12, a sliding groove 24 is formed in the side surface of the bottom of the clamping plate 17, the sliding groove 24 is slidably installed on a sliding rail 18, a clamping groove 21 in a, and the vertical side of the bottom of the clamping groove 21 is provided with a horizontal transverse guide groove 23, the clamp plate 17 and the test tube fixing frame 12 are made of PE transparent plastic, the thickness of the side plate 20 arranged around the outer side of the test tube fixing frame 12 is the same as that of the clamp plate 17, the inner part of the clamping groove 21 arranged in the clamp plate 17 is adhered with a medical silica gel pad through glue, two rows of test tube fixing holes 16 arranged on the test tube fixing frame 12, slide rails 18 are fixed at the bottoms of the test tube fixing frames 12 at the two sides of the test tube fixing holes 16, the clamp plate 17 is slidably arranged on the slide rails 18, two groups of corresponding clamp plates 17 are arranged at the front side and the rear side of the bottom of the test tube fixing holes 16, meanwhile, the clamp plate 17 arranged at the outer side of the test tube fixing holes 16 is fixed with clamp plate springs 19, the rear ends of the clamp plate springs 19 are fixed on the side plates 20, and the rear end of the clamp plate spring 19 is fixed on the test tube fixing frame 12, the rubber pad 14 is fixed at the bottom of the temporary storage box cover 13 arranged at the upper end of the temporary storage box 1, the quadrangular frustum pyramid structure of the rubber pad 14 is matched with the protective sleeve 10, and the ultraviolet disinfection lamp 9 is arranged on the temporary storage box cover 13 inside the rubber pad 14.
The working principle is as follows: when using clinical examination to use body fluid sample temporary storage device, at first lift temporary storage case lid 13, insert sample test tube 11 at the inside test tube fixed orifices 16 middle parts of test tube fixed mount 12, and the splint 17 that test tube fixed orifices 16 below set up is inside to be seted up and to press from both sides groove 21, the slope guide way 22 that presss from both sides the inside setting of groove 21 plays the guide effect, and the horizontal guide way 23 of clamp 21 bottom setting is effectual improves sample test tube 11's stability, sample test tube 11 struts the splint 17 of both sides installation, later splint spring 19 promotes splint 17 and presss from both sides sample test tube 11 tightly, 11 bottom sprag of sample test tube are on silica gel column 5 simultaneously, it rocks to place sample test tube 11, guide pin bushing 7 that interior box 8 bottoms set up goes up and down on guide bar 4 simultaneously, play the cushioning effect, control switch 2 starts ultraviolet disinfection lamp 9 and lights, the work of disinfecting.
